Output f5fd16f7094df13ff4a300be9a051686305c61e623493b339ae196cdd92734a1:1

value
18027651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f39506a13a1d43de94fbd800357e361a10dd6d4b OP_EQUAL
address
3PtxefCcF4YDkLKc3AHrnkTtwFtQUiMKeN
transaction
f5fd16f7094df13ff4a300be9a051686305c61e623493b339ae196cdd92734a1
confirmations
257037
spent
true